Virulently homophobic ‘Christian’ Franklin Graham took to Facebook to applaud the First Baptist Church of Jacksonville, which requires every member to sign an anti-LGBTQ pledge or face being ejected from the church.

In fact, Graham believes all churches should institute similar hate vows.

Via Facebook:

Many churches today are being influenced by culture when it should be the other way around—the church should be influencing culture with the Word of God.

There are denominations and many churches that have compromised on what God’s Word says about things such as homosexuality, marriage, and abortion.

First Baptist Church of Jacksonville requires members to sign in agreement with a statement on Biblical sexuality. I think this is something that every church in America should adopt.

This takes the ifs, ands, and buts out of it: “As a member of First Baptist Church, I believe that God creates people in his image as either male or female, and that this creation is a fixed matter of human biology, not individual choice. I believe marriage is instituted by God, not government, is between one man and one woman, and is the only context for sexual desire and expression.”

Way to go First Baptist Church of Jacksonville! I hope thousands of churches will follow your example. God bless you!
